Bobon, officially the Municipality of Bobon (Waray: Bungto han Bobon; Tagalog: Bayan ng Bobon), is a municipality in the province of Northern Samar, Philippines. According to the 2024 census, it has a population of 27,266 people.[4]

Geography

The town borders with Catarman in the east and San Jose in the west.

Barangays

Bobon is politically subdivided into 18 barangays. Each barangay consists of puroks and some have sitios.

  • Acerida
  • Arellano
  • Balat-balud
  • Dancalan
  • E. Duran (Himaraganan)
  • Gen. Lucban (Poblacion)
  • Jose Abad Santos
  • Jose P. Laurel (Casulgan)
  • Magsaysay (Doce)
  • Calantiao (Pangobi-an)
  • Quezon (Panicayan)
  • Salvacion
  • San Isidro
  • San Juan (Poblacion)
  • Santa Clara (Poblacion)
  • Santander
  • Somoroy
  • Trojello
